The core responsibilities of this role include:Kit assembly read work orders, blueprints and standard operating procedures (SOPs) to pull and package exact parts, tools or materials.

- Inventory Control: Monitor stock levels, track part shortages, and use warehouse management or inventory software to process finished kits.
- Quality Assurance: Verify that components match part numbers, check for defects or damage before packing and accurately label kits.
- Staging and Delivery: Deliver completed kits to production lines, assembly floores, or designated work areas to prevent workflow delays.
- Safety & Compliance: Adhere to strict workplace regulations, which often include FOD (Foreign Object Debris) prevention and using PPE like steel-toe shoes or cleanroom suits.
- Experience: 1-3 years in manufacturing, warehousing or production environment
- Physical Demands: able to stand or walk for long periods and regularly lift up to 50lbs.
- Skills: Strong basic math, basic computer and database skills and excellent organizational abilities

Kitting Technician Role Profile
Role Purpose:
The kitting technician will be required to assemble, inspect, clean, package and kit machined parts and bought-in items necessary for various customized types of kits.
Key Accountabilities:
- Responsible to assemble components and produce quality work, free from errors in a clean room environment.
- Responsible for area and tool maintenance & cleanliness.
- Responsible for various complex assembly work of modified parts to produce customized kits.
- Responsible for inventory management and control.
- Knowledge and ability to use tools to assemble parts.
- Must be able to work independently and as part of a team to ensure production goals are met.
- Perform additional duties as assigned.
- Associate Degree or equivalent in a related field of study
- Forklift operator certificate or satisfactory completion of a forklift-training program within the first 30 days of employment
- Must have 6 months experience in a complex kitting, assembly environment
